Clear All Filters
Navy Blue Knitted Beanie Hat (1-16yrs)
£4 - £8
Cobalt Blue Plated Knitted Beanie Hat (1-16yrs)
£5 - £9
Navy Blue Baby Waffle Pom Hat (0mths-2yrs)
£6
Pale Blue Double Pom Knitted Baby Hat (0mths-2yrs)
£7